Hey guys, so I have a standard heated (Non AC) leather seats in my 14' Sierra SLT but was playing with the idea of getting aftermarket heated/cooled seats. My bro got nearly the same truck as I did and he opted for AC seats. He was complaining to me that the seats don't work to great and cause a lot of wanted noise. I drove his truck around today and found that the while the AC feature is noticeable on high, it was very minimal (Low and Medium could not really be felt). I too wasn't a fan of the noise the fans put out. So while talking to my dealer, he recommended I go the aftermarket route.

 

In this case, he was referring to the Class Soft Trim. Also read about the Katzkin seats, which too look nice. Have any of you had any experience with either brand? Also, one of my biggest deciding factor of with getting the aftermarket seats is having everything look and function like stock. While I know the seats will look stock, the controls for them are going to be along the seat and not on the dash like my stock heated buttons. Do you guys think it would be possible to run the wiring in a way as to still be able use the stock heated buttons on the dash and just use the AC button on the seat? That way it's all looks and functions like OEM?

So called CST and asked em personally if they could utilize stock seat heated button on dash since the stock wiring still runs under the seat and will remain in place. They said they could play with it during the install but no guarantees. I'm no electrical guru but for any of you guys who are, you guys think it's doable? My only concern is that the button on the aftermarket seat setup is on the side of the seats and is used to turn on both AC and heat so not sure if it's different wiring harnesses.

Went to my local Katzkin dealer and got a tour of the place to see what kind of work they did and to get a price quote. Katzkin has their brand of cooled seats called Degreez. Was impressed how many vehicle interiors (leather, sunroofs etc) they do a month (80-100 per month) and all the cars there were brand new as they contract with most local dealers to add options clients want. Their leather looks top notch (oem leather for Chrysler, jeep dodge etc) Because I didn't have perforated leather, I would have to install that. Cost is $995 for front seats including install and I got quoted $1400 for leather with Degreez cooled seats installed. I would still use my oem heaters so the stock switches would work like normal and the AC button would be located where ever I wanted, but I think I would go with side of seat near position controls.
